Publisher's Synopsis

This Irish memoir tells the story of an unusual childhood.  The child of academic parents, the author was transplanted from Illinois to rural Wicklow in the 1950s.  While his classicist father continued to spend part of the year teaching at the University of Chicago, he with his sister and philosopher mother Marjorie Grene settled down on the family farm in Ballinaclash.
